What's Happening?
Lionel Messi is reportedly close to signing a new multiyear contract with Inter Miami, extending his stay with the Major League Soccer (MLS) team. The Argentine superstar joined Inter Miami in July 2023 and has since become the team's all-time leading goalscorer. The new deal is expected to keep him with the club through at least 2026. This extension comes as Inter Miami prepares to open a new stadium, with Messi's presence being a significant draw for fans and ticket sales.
Why It's Important?
Messi's continued presence in MLS is a major boost for the league, enhancing its global profile and attracting international attention. His performance has already led to increased ticket sales and viewership, and his extension could further solidify MLS's reputation as a competitive league. For Inter Miami, retaining Messi is crucial for maintaining fan interest and financial success, especially with the upcoming stadium opening. This move also underscores the growing trend of international stars joining MLS, which could influence other players to consider similar moves.
